BUFFALO, NY – The #17 Buffalo State men's soccer team battled to a draw against the Hobart College Statesmen 0-0 in their last regular season matchup of the season.
THE BASICS
FINAL SCORE: #17 Buffalo State – 0, Hobart College – 0
LOCATION: Coyer Field – Buffalo, NY
RECORDS: Buffalo State: 13-1-3 (7-1-1 SUNYAC), Hobart College: 5-5-5 (4-2-2 Liberty League)
INSIDE THE BENGAL BOX SCORE
- Diego Rivera (East Meadow, NY/Cairo Durham) led the Bengals with five shots. Frank Colella (Staten Island, NY/Tottenville) and Sa-Jan Magar (Cheektowaga, NY/McKinley) both were credited with a shot on goal.
- Shae Wirt (Overland Park, KS/St. Thomas Aquinas) completed a full game shutout, making five saves in net, and tallying his ninth shutout of the season.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- In their regular season finale, the Bengals came out the gate controlling tempo and play early. A couple early shots for the Bengals had the Statesmen worried, but the Statesmen would respond with their own offensive attack putting the pressure on the Bengals defense.
- Things would remain an even fight, as both teams looked to gain the goal advantage before the halftime whistle. As neither offense was able to get behind each other's defense, both teams would go into halftime tied at 0.
- The second half would continue the same fight, with each team looking to generate chances at the net. Play started to intensify late into the second half…but on a breezy night at Coyer Field, the Bengals and the Statesmen were unable to get the game-winning goal, finishing today's non-conference bout in a 0-0 draw.
- The Bengals were outshot by the Statesmen 15 to 12, with five shots on net for the Statesmen, to the Bengals two.
FOR THE FOES
- Keegan Mulroony led the Statesmen with five shots, with one on goal.
- Thomas Chyzowych kept the Bengals off the board, tallying two saves in net in 90 minutes of play.
